Output 0cb43a99a45bbe4c6fac519f0a5a77f50d56f1eaf2a31838edc96761d1f290d6:3

value
70416388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0fa9657767a91b860f0d33c2db7632b62cae40 OP_EQUAL
address
3QaWHtRnftpe8vLsUrwJMxAB3F7XSD4W4a
transaction
0cb43a99a45bbe4c6fac519f0a5a77f50d56f1eaf2a31838edc96761d1f290d6
spent
true